Output 51af77a016323422a02cd8d1d83ab0f4bbb08794f28a5eed3f21d24df571a150:8

value
3302568
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7462ff9e912d7cc94cb4ca04aef3a0b675307266 OP_EQUALVERIFY OP_CHECKSIG
address
1BcPynoHYaJFWGHY4Zh4aWEtZc919tFiWb
transaction
51af77a016323422a02cd8d1d83ab0f4bbb08794f28a5eed3f21d24df571a150
spent
true